What is the process of making a comic strip?
The process usually starts with coming up with an idea or story. Then, you do rough sketches of the characters and scenes. Next, you refine those sketches and add details. After that, you ink the final lines and maybe add color. Finally, you add any text or speech bubbles.

What are the tips for making a comic strip?
For making a great comic strip, start with simple sketches to flesh out your ideas. Focus on the flow of the story - make sure each panel leads smoothly to the next. And don't forget about the dialogue - keep it short and engaging!
